7/22/09 N.Y. St. Reg. PSC-29-09-00012-P
PURSUANT TO THE PROVISIONS OF THE State Administrative Procedure Act, NOTICE is hereby given of the following proposed rule:
Proposed Action:
The Public Service Commission is considering whether to grant, deny or modify, in whole or part, the petition filed by Highland Senior Residence, LLC, to submeter electricity at 34 Highland Avenue, Yonkers, New York.
Statutory authority:
Public Service Law, sections 2, 4(1), 65(1), 66(1), (2), (3), (4), (12) and (14)
Subject:
Petition for the submetering of electricity at a residential senior citizen facility.
Purpose:
To consider the request of Highland Senior Residence, LLC to submeter electricity at 34 Highland Ave., Yonkers, New York.
Substance of proposed rule:
The Public Service Commission is considering whether to grant, deny or modify, in whole or part, the petition filed by Highland Senior Residence, LLC, to submeter electricity at 34 Highland Avenue, Yonkers, New York, located in the territory of Consolidated Edison Company of New York, Inc. Highland Senior Residence, LLC intends to house and operate a residential senior citizen facility.
